Aluminium is a versatile metal that is commonly used in various industries due to its lightweight nature and high resistance to corrosion Etching aluminium is a process that involves using chemicals to create intricate designs or patterns on the surface of the metal This process is often used in the manufacturing of electronics, aerospace components, and decorative items.
Etching aluminium can be done using different methods, such as chemical etching, electrochemical etching, or laser etching Each method has its own advantages and is chosen based on the specific requirements of the project In this article, we will focus on chemical etching, which is a popular method for etching aluminium.
Chemical etching of aluminium involves the use of an etchant solution that selectively removes the desired areas of the metal surface The etchant solution is typically a mixture of acids and other chemicals that react with the aluminium to create the desired effect The process involves several steps, including cleaning the metal surface, applying a resist material to protect the areas that do not need to be etched, and then etching the exposed areas with the etchant solution.
The first step in etching aluminium is to prepare the metal surface by cleaning it thoroughly to remove any dirt, grease, or other contaminants This ensures that the etchant solution can come into direct contact with the aluminium surface and etch it effectively Once the surface is clean, a resist material is applied to protect the areas that do not need to be etched This resist material can be a special type of tape, a film, or a liquid that is applied to the surface using a brush or spray.
After the resist material is applied, the next step is to expose the areas that need to be etched by removing the resist material This can be done using a variety of methods, such as cutting, peeling, or washing off the resist material etch aluminium. Once the desired areas are exposed, the aluminium is ready to be etched with the etchant solution.
The etchant solution is carefully applied to the exposed areas of the aluminium surface using a brush, spray, or immersion method The etchant reacts with the aluminium, causing it to dissolve and create the desired patterns or designs The etching process can take anywhere from a few minutes to several hours, depending on the type of etchant solution used and the complexity of the design.
After the etching process is complete, the aluminium is thoroughly rinsed with water to remove any remaining etchant solution and neutralize the surface The resist material is then removed, revealing the final etched design on the aluminium surface The surface can be further treated with a protective coating to enhance its durability and preserve the etched design.
